Who are family physicians?


Family physicians are medical specialists who care for patients of all ages and ethnicities. They help prevent, evaluate, diagnose, and treat chronic conditions like diabetes and heart disorders. They also manage common everyday medical issues such as flu and allergies and can practice in various settings, both private and public. 


Family physicians perform routine health check-ups, well-baby check-ups for babies and children, and health risk assessments for anyone at risk. They also carry out screening tests for genetic disorders and illnesses common in particular genders, such as pap smears and prostate exams. They monitor children's immunization schedules and take care of all timely vaccinations. They also counsel patients about healthy lifestyle choices, including quitting smoking, alcohol, and drugs. Family physicians also make timely referrals to specialists in all fields, which helps save lives.


Family care physicians are at the forefront of primary care. The in-depth knowledge of the human body and a passion for patient care make family practice physicians a practical and unique specialty. Access to regular primary care via family physicians has been directly linked to the following:


  • Long and healthy life
  • Higher immunization rates
  • Low healthcare costs
  • High birth weights in infants
  • Low infant mortality rates


Educational background of family physicians


In the U.S., the journey of becoming a family physician involves completing four years of medical school after getting an undergraduate degree in science, followed by a mandatory three to four years residency with rotations in all fields of medicine. The Comprehensive Osteopathic Medical Licensing Examination of the United States of America (COMLEX-USA) or the United States Medical Licensing Examination (USMLE) conducts the board examination for family physicians. 


Some states in the U.S. have an additional requirement of clearing a license examination to practice in that state legally. All family physicians in the U.S. must pass the assessment provided by the American Board of Family Medicine (ABFM) or the American Osteopathic Board of Family Physicians (AOBFP) to be called board-certified. They may further streamline their education and specialize in areas like emergency medicine, sports medicine, public health, gynecology, or mental health. 


Subspecialties in family medicine


As explained above, family practice physicians may undergo further training to specialize in any of the following family medicine subspecialties:


  • Pain medicine: The subspecialty focuses on patients suffering from chronic, acute, or cancer-related pain in outpatient and hospital settings. These specialists also coordinate with other doctors and medical professionals to optimize patient care.
  • Adolescent medicine: It is a multidisciplinary healthcare specialization focusing on adolescents' unique social, physical, and psychological characteristics and medical needs.
  • Hospice and palliative medicine: This subspecialty deals with patients suffering from life-limiting illnesses. These specialists work with palliative or hospice care teams to address the patient's and their family's social, physical, spiritual, and psychological needs, improving their overall quality of life.
  • Sports medicine: Sports medicine focuses on preventing, diagnosing, and treating sports and exercise-related injuries or problems. It also deals with diseases and illnesses that affect physical performance. 
  • Geriatric medicine: Geriatric medicine deals with elderly care. It focuses on specific skills to prevent, diagnose, manage, rehabilitate, and treat conditions in older adults. These specialists care for elderly patients at home, offices, hospitals, and nursing homes. 
  • Sleep medicine: This field focuses on diagnosing and managing clinical problems affecting the normal sleep cycle or sleep quality. Specialists are trained to interpret and analyze comprehensive polysomnography and effectively manage a sleep laboratory.
  • Healthcare administration: This subspecialty equips a physician with comprehensive expertise in managing administrative functions in healthcare. They focus on organizational effectiveness, patient experience, and patient safety. These specialists work with stakeholders to create a robust, patient-centric healthcare system.


What procedures can family physicians perform?


Family physicians can perform various in-office procedures as part of patient care, such as: 


  • Maternity related procedures
  • Early pregnancy management and evaluation and family planning-related procedures
  • Intrauterine device (IUD) placement
  • Endoscopy
  • Colonoscopy
  • Vasectomy
  • Suturing lacerations
  • Colposcopy
  • Skin biopsy and more


Why should you visit a family physician?


Family physicians are generally the first point of contact for conditions as simple as mild allergies and as complex as cancer. Family physicians carry the answers to most questions concerning your health, whether it is about timely diagnosis and care or referral to the right specialist. A relationship with a family physician begins as soon as a child is born and continues till the last years of one's life. They know your medical history in depth and have thorough knowledge about your family's history, helping them make accurate diagnoses and monitor your treatment.


Family physicians offer services ranging from regular yearly check-ups to treatment for chronic medical illnesses. They diagnose and manage diabetes, heart diseases, hypertension, and arthritis, treating flu, sinus infections, warts, and seasonal allergies. They thoroughly understand your priorities, financial background, and family and personal history for severe conditions such as cancer, neurological disorders, and major surgeries and refer you to the right specialists. By saving visits to the emergency room when not needed and reducing the need for follow-up visits, family physicians can help take care of your medical needs in the most economical way possible.


The benefits mentioned above are backed by research. A 2021 study published by the National Academies of Sciences, Engineering, and Medicine states that primary care is the very foundation of the healthcare system and that an increased supply of primary care is linked to better population health and more equitable outcomes. Further, a 2019 patient-centered medical home (PCMH) report also found that increased primary care (PC) spending is related to fewer emergency department visits, total hospitalizations, and hospitalizations for ambulatory care-sensitive conditions.


How to select a family physician for you and your family?


Finding the right primary care provider or family physician is an important decision for you and your family, and it's completely understandable to want to find the right fit quickly. While asking friends and family for their recommendations can be a great starting point, here are some other important tips to help guide you as you navigate this process:


  • If you have insurance, check which healthcare providers near you are covered by your insurance health plan. An in-network primary care doctor will help keep your medical costs in check. If you do not have insurance and are paying out-of-pocket, you should speak to your doctor's office about costs before setting up an appointment to avoid any surprise charges. It is also important to note that several health insurance providers limit your choice to a list of doctors and require you to select a doctor from their list. Ensure you contact your insurance provider for such information.
  • Credentials are important when searching for a provider. A family physician who is board-certified by the American Board of Family Medicine (ABFM) adheres to the highest standards of care and is aware of the latest advancements in family medicine. They must also complete at least 150 hours of continuing medical education every three years.
  • Check whether a family doctor is affiliated with a hospital and if that hospital is covered by your insurance. This may be important if you have health needs that require you to go to a hospital. 
  • Location is another critical factor in choosing your family doctor. Check if the doctor's office is located near your home, office, or school. If your area lacks primary care offices, you should check for other facilities such as community health clinics, hospital emergency rooms, and public clinics instead of primary care physician offices.
  • You may also want to know whether minor procedures or tests, such as X-rays, will be performed in the doctor's clinic or in a lab facility elsewhere. 
  • When choosing a provider, it is essential to learn the timings of your doctor's clinic. Ask your physician's office if they offer assistance for issues that may occur after hours and if a medical query can be answered over the phone or online. 
  • Some doctors practice independently, while others may be a part of a group practice. It's important to know if you have access to other healthcare practitioners, such as nurse practitioners, physician assistants, and other medical specialists, for current or future needs. 
  • Before choosing a primary care provider, you must also check if they accommodate your special health needs. A person's age, gender, life experiences, disability status, trauma, abuse, mental health, and chronic medical conditions create unique health challenges that any healthcare provider must understand and accommodate when developing treatment plans.


What to expect from an appointment with a family physician?


You must carry all your essential medical documents during your first visit with a family physician near you. After completing the medical history questionnaire provided by the doctor's office, they will study your records and past medical and procedural history. Call the doctor's office a day or two in advance to ask for any particular medication or diet instructions you must follow before seeing the family physician.


How to prepare for your first family doctor appointment?


Preparing for your first family physician appointment will help you get the most out of your visit and get timely preventive care, save on future medical costs, and ultimately lead to better health outcomes.


Here's how you can prepare for your first family doctor appointment: 


  • Ensure you bring all relevant documents: This includes all your previous health records, prescriptions, insurance card, a list of over-the-counter medications you are currently taking (including vitamins and supplements), and prior tests or surgeries performed. If you have ever been treated in an emergency department by a specialist, inform your family doctor. These details will help your provider diagnose accurately and keep your overall health in mind for future visits. Further, you must also notify your doctor if anyone in your close family has a history of chronic illness.
  • Maintain a record of all your symptoms: It is essential to note all your recurring symptoms and their frequency, duration, and what triggers them. Changes in your diet, sleep patterns, weight, moods, and menstrual cycle could indicate an underlying health condition. 
  • Ask someone to accompany you: If you are bilingual or English is not your first language and need help translating, you can ask a friend or family member to translate during your appointment. This can also help you calm your nerves and feel less stressed during the session. They can also take notes on your behalf and raise any questions you may have forgotten.
  • Prioritize your concerns and carry a list of questions: Your first appointment may take quite some time. You may also have many questions regarding your diagnosis, treatment options, tests needed, surgical options, medical costs, follow-up appointments, and more. It is advisable to carry a list of these to ensure you remember all critical queries while you are with your doctor.

Family medicine statistics in Tucson, AZ


As per a U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ics report, as of May 2021, around 2,610 licensed family physicians were practicing in Arizona. 


The city of Tucson, Arizona, comes under Pima County. Per the 2021 Pima County Community Health Needs Assessment, cancer, heart diseases, accidents, chronic lower respiratory diseases, and cerebrovascular diseases were the county's top 5 causes of death in 2019. In 2018, there was one family physician for every 1,167 people in Pima County. 


In 2018, about 13.3% of adults in Pima County had been diagnosed with diabetes; the death rate per 100,000 population was close to 26.2. In the same year, nearly 7.7% of adults had coronary heart disease, with a death rate of around 97.8. Pima County has had an approximately 25% increase in adult obesity rates between 2014 and 2018.
